Bond set for man charged with striking Columbus police officer

Bond is set at 15-thousand dollars for the man accused of striking a Columbus police officer and a woman with an SUV on Sunday. 41-year-old Alphonso Jennings III allegedly struck police sergeant Steve Livingston and Morgan Salisbury on the ramp from I-71 north to I-270 west while Livingston responded to a report of a crash. Both remain hospitalized. Prosecutors say Jennings was under the influence of alcohol and/or drugs at the time.
